Ingredients
For the Crust:
- 1 ½ cups graham cracker crumbs
- ¼ cup granulated sugar
- 6 tbsp unsalted butter, melted
For the Filling:
- 1 cup creamy peanut butter
- 1 package (8 oz) cream cheese, softened
- 1 cup powdered sugar
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- 1 cup heavy cream, whipped
For the Topping (Optional):
- Whipped cream
- Crushed peanuts
- Chocolate shavings or drizzle
Step-by-Step Instructions
Step 1: Prepare the Crust
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C) (optional).
In a bowl, mix graham cracker crumbs, sugar, and melted butter until well combined.
Press mixture into a 9-inch pie dish, covering the bottom and sides evenly.
Bake for 8-10 minutes for a firmer crust, or chill in the fridge for a no-bake version. Let cool completely.
Step 2: Make the Filling
In a large bowl, beat together peanut butter, cream cheese, powdered sugar, and vanilla extract until smooth and creamy.
Gently fold in whipped cream until fully incorporated.
Step 3: Assemble the Pie
Pour the peanut butter filling into the cooled crust. Smooth the top with a spatula.
Step 4: Chill
Refrigerate for at least 4 hours or until fully set.
Step 5: Add Toppings & Serve
Before serving, top with whipped cream, crushed peanuts, and a drizzle of chocolate if desired.
Slice and enjoy!

Tips for the Best Peanut Butter Cream Pie
- Use Full-Fat Cream Cheese – This ensures the filling is ultra-creamy.
- Chill Thoroughly – The longer it chills, the better the texture.
- Swap the Crust – Use Oreo crumbs or a baked pastry crust for variety.
Storage & Reheating
- Refrigeration: Store in an airtight container for up to 5 days.
- Freezing: Freeze for up to 3 months, wrapped tightly. Thaw in the fridge before serving.
FAQs
Can I make this ahead of time?
Yes! It’s best when made a day in advance and chilled overnight.
What can I use instead of peanut butter?
You can use almond butter or sunflower butter for an alternative.
Can I make it without cream cheese?
Yes! Substitute with mascarpone cheese or extra whipped cream for a lighter version.
